    STUNNING FARM WITH FABULOUS VIEWS IN THE YORKSHIRE DALES NATIONAL PARK

    Sam AllcockBy Sam Allcock11/01/2024No Comments5 Mins Read3 Views
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Telegram LinkedIn Tumblr Email Reddit
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p Email

    Crake Trees Manor Farm is a superb mixed farm in a beautiful location in the Yorkshire Dales National Park, combining a stunning farmhouse, an established holiday lets and glamping business and significant environmental potential.

    The property includes land of about 154 acres, a five-bedroom farmhouse and annex, a detached two-bedroom bungalow, a traditional barn with permission to convert, as well as outbuildings, four camping pods and a camping field for up to 40 tents. The tourism business has generated over £200,000 per annum in recent years.

    The landholding includes arable and pasture, with areas of woodland, as well as ponds, hedgerows and shelter belts recently planted to provide habitats for wildlife.

    Opportunities abound at Crake Trees Manor Farm – there is a traditional barn which has planning consent for change of use to form a two-bedroom house for instance.

    Enjoying the most spectacular panoramic views over the Pennine Ridge, the property is also easily accessible to transport links and is on the edge of the idyllic conservation village of Maulds Meaburn.

    Sam Gibson, a partner with Galbraith, said: “Crake Trees Manor is a highly desirable place to live, with excellent potential to generate a good income from the various tourism elements and the land. It is for sale as a whole or in any combination of up to 11 lots.

    “The farmhouse is a hugely versatile and attractive home with impressive open-plan spaces making the most of the stunning views, combined with cosy, smaller rooms for the winter months. The location is hard to beat, between the Yorkshire Dales and Lake District National Parks, while the North Pennines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ty is also on the doorstep. Crake Trees Manor Farm offers a superb rural lifestyle in one of the most beautiful parts of the country.”

    The spacious accommodation in the farmhouse includes up to seven bedrooms, seven bathrooms, superb light-filled reception spaces and framed views from many rooms. The property offers a wealth of attractive features including original fireplaces, flagged stone floors, exposed beams, a galleried landing and vaulted ceilings. These have been enhanced by imaginative improvements using locally sourced materials to create a modern and edgy aesthetic.

    The impressive kitchen with adjoining conservatory and dining hall/sitting room forms the heart of the home. Also on the ground floor are a snug, boot room, utility, office, laundry room and shower room. There is the potential to repurpose some of these rooms and create additional bedrooms if required, as two of these rooms are serviced by en-suite shower rooms. There is also the potential to offer holiday lets or B & B accommodation from these rooms, which have independent access.

    There are five well-proportioned double bedrooms on the first floor, three of which are en-suite. A separate family bathroom services the remaining two bedrooms on the first floor.

    The main house is at the heart of the 154 acres, in a beautiful location at the end of a long sweeping drive. The property is surrounded by rolling fields and open countryside with landscaped gardens, terraced seating areas and grounds. The excellent outbuildings have been used as a bunkhouse and catering kitchen for the successful glamping business.

    The farm lies on the rural fringe of the conservation village of Maulds Meaburn in the Yorkshire Dales National Park and is around 6 miles from the Lake District National Park. It has excellent local amenities with a pub and primary school nearby.

    The historic market town of Appleby is a short drive away, where there are further amenities, schools, shops and leisure facilities. The larger market Town of Penrith, some 15 miles away, has a wider range of shops and amenities.

    The area surrounding Crake Trees Manor Farm provides access to beautiful walking, cycling and riding routes in the Yorkshire Dales and Lake District National Parks and the North Pennines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.

    Nearby transport connections include the A66 (approximately 5 miles) and the M6, which provides access towards Penrith and the Lake District. There are also train stations at Penrith and Oxenholme on the West Coast Main Line with additional cross country rail services, providing rail links to Hexham and Newcastle.

    The property is for sale as a whole or in separate lots.

    Crake Trees Manor Farm is for sale through Galbraith as a whole for Offers In Excess of £2,800,000.
